The related quest is
守备官的请求
and the description of T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ru is:
The Draenei had to flee from many worlds as the Legion chased after them across the heavens.
It is upon one of these worlds where a valiant few remained with the radiant jewel of healing, T'uure, to face the Legion and allow their friends to escape.
A rumor is spreading that a soldier in Dalaran has seen the lost crystal in possession of the Legion. If this is true it must be retrieved!
The first quest
牧师的事务
is one all priests must complete to select their artifact weapon in Tirisfal Glades.
Alonsus Faol, the former leader of Holy Order of Northshire Clerics, is revealed to have been raised as a member of the Scourge and now is taking a more public role in fighting the Legion. While his story is mostly told in the Shadow Priest Artifact, he is the NPC you must speak with to choose any priest artifact weapon.
I apologize for the secrecy, old habits die hard. I am Alonsus Faol. At times I have been the elader of a church, a mindless minion of the Scourge, and a commander ina secret war. But I have always been a priest first.
The Legion is a threat I cannot ignore so I have decided to step out from the shadows. I am working on gathering priesthoods of all denominations to address this threat together.
At its head would be a priest that has proven his or her ability so often they are a hero to all people. I believe you are that hero, but others still need convincing. Will you take on this challenge?
In
守备官的请求
, you travel to the Dalaran First Aid building to meet the paladin Vindicator Boros and a solider that suffered severe wounds. In the followup quest,
援助请求
, you heal the soldier, who mumbles something about T'uure, the artifact. When the soldier is healed, he says:
I must have been dreaming of Alora, she was my cell mate in that accursed world the demons took me to. She told me she saw the crystal but never said much else.
I just hope she is still alive.
You travel back to Darkstone Isle in
脱离黑暗
to rescue Alora, who tells you about T'uure in thanks for saving her life. She starts to tell you about the weapon in
神圣的救赎
, but you are interrupted by attacks from
征服者瓦里斯
. With the unexpected help of Demon Hunter Jace Darkweaver, you defeat the Demon and travel through the demonic portal to Niskara, where the wielder of T'uure resides.
Jace Darkweaver is eager to help you as well:
You seek a demon with a staff of crystal? The Eredar that calls itself Lady Calindris has one that matches your description perfectly.
She's MY prey though! I've been chasing her minion all over the isles and I'm not about to let this opportunity pass.
I could use someone to watch my back though. If you help me out I'd be willing to let you take this staff you seek. I don't care about her equipment, it's her soul that I'm after.
圣光回归
sends you to
尼斯卡拉
and begins the Artifact Acquisition scenario.

Artifact Book Text
As players progress with their Artifact Knowledge research, more pages unlock in the Artifact Book in your Class Hall:
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ru
T'uure is one of the purest physical embodiments of the Light in existence. The dynamic energies that flow through this artifact can heal wounds both physical and mental. They can inspire hope in times of overwhelming darkness, and fortify timid hearts with courage.
But perhaps T'uure's greatest strength is what we can learn from its past. If there is one thing to take away from its history, it is this: even one brave soul wielding the Light can save the lives of thousands.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part One
The draenei have many legends about the benevolent naaru. Few are as cherished as the tale of T'uure.
Like other naaru, T'uure vowed to protect all mortal civilizations in the universe from the clutches of darkness. This noble quest eventually led the holy being to a world called Karkora. Its mortal denizens faced annihilation at the hands of a monstrous entity known as Dimensius the All-Devouring.
As Dimensius shrouded Karkora in Void energies, T'uure expended its own life force to spare the world from doom. The naaru shattered into fragments and sparked a colossal holy nova. The energy cascaded over Karkora, washing away the void and banishing Dimensius from the world.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Two
From the draenei holy tome entitled Lessons in Hope and Sacrifice:
""T'uure had shattered, but even broken, its Light was undiminished. Each piece blazed like a star, drawing naaru from the far corners of creation. They scooped up T'uure's glittering fragments, and they sang songs of the sacrifice that had saved a world.
""The naaru gifted these shards to various races that they believed showed potential for good. The largest piece of T'uure was passed to our own ancestors: the ancient eredar of Argus.
""It is said that this artifact plummeted from the sky like a falling star. Night turned to day, and T'uure's glorious Light painted the heavens in shades of gold for a full week.""
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Three
The eredar were a highly erudite people who cherished learning, and they studied T'uure with great curiosity. The first among them to truly harness the artifact's power for good was the wise leader named Velen.
During Velen's time, a strange curse spread across Argus. The victims found their minds addled, their memories diminished. Few things terrified the eredar as much as losing their precious knowledge. They reacted with fear and paranoia. To prevent others from contracting the affliction, many of the eredar considered quarantining the cursed or even banishing them from Argus.
Yet Velen would not abandon his people. At great risk to himself, he walked among the cursed with T'uure in hand. Velen called upon the artifact's powers and cured all of the stricken eredar.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Four
An excerpt from The Corruption of the Eredar and the Flight of the Draenei, by the historian Llore:
""When Sargeras came to Argus to corrupt the eredar, nearly all fell under his sway. Velen and his followers were the exception. With the naaru's help, they embarked on a harrowing escape from their home. The going was not easy. Demons awaited the fleeing eredar at every corner.
""Despair gripped the renegades, and many even considered giving up. It was during this dark and trying time that Velen brought T'uure to bear. Its brilliant energies shone before the renegades and renewed their dwindling confidence. Emboldened by the artifact, Velen's followers believed that they could do the impossible, that they could complete their daring flight from Argus. And so they did.
""From that day forward, the renegades called themselves the draenei. It is a name that everyone on Azeroth now knows. But if not for T'uure, perhaps the draenei would have never come to be.""
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Five
Aboard a dimensional fortress called the Genedar, the draenei fled across the stars. The demons pursued them relentlessly, determined to punish the renegades for escaping corruption.
The long millennia that followed were harsh on the draenei. They could not rest. The threat of capture haunted their dreams. To defend themselves against the Legion, many turned to T'uure and other holy artifacts brought from Argus. The draenei studied these relics and honed their connection to the Light under the tutelage of Velen and the naaru.
A student named Askara showed more promise than the rest. In time, she would earn the right to carry T'uure, and she would become one of the greatest healers the draenei would ever know.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Six
Askara had lost her entire family on Argus, but she found a new one aboard the Genedar. She saw the draenei as her brothers and sisters, and she vowed to do whatever she could to protect them.
Yet she was not gifted with physical strength or a talent for forging armaments. Instead, she turned to the Light. Her mastery of holy magic became so great that Velen eventually gave T'uure to her. Askara spent her every waking hour studying the artifact and unlocking its extraordinary potential.
It was during this time that Askara received a vision of the future. She foresaw her people finding a sanctuary from the Legion. A new life. A new world to call home.
But strangely, she did not see herself there.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Seven
The draenei visited many different worlds in search of a safe haven, but they rarely stayed for very long before the Burning Legion would learn of their whereabouts. Before the demons could confront them, the draenei would gather aboard the Genedar and disappear into the stars once again.
The Legion's relentless pursuit bred depression and pessimism in many draenei, but they did not suffer in silence. Askara sought out her forlorn kin and spoke to them of their troubles. She carried T'uure with her at all times, the relic casting an aura of holy magic around her that lifted the other draenei's spirits.
""It is true that the Legion is vast and mighty, but they do not stand in the Light as we do,"" Askara often said. ""No matter how strong our enemy is, if they walk in darkness, they will always stumble and fall.""
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Eight
From the draenei holy tome entitled The Second Sun of Shar'gel:
""The Burning Legion had lain in wait for us on Shar'gel, watching as we disembarked from the Genedar and set foot on the world. We believed we had found a place to settle. A place to start over again.
""We were wrong.
""Fel portals screamed open all around us, spewing forth doomguards, felhounds, and other horrors. The Legion's forces cornered us, cutting off our retreat to the Genedar. I thought we were done for.
""Then I saw... her. I saw Askara.
""She planted herself between us and the demons, T'uure held high. A storm of light erupted around her, blinding the Legion's minions and shielding us from their fel-touched blades. As we battled our way to the Genedar, T'uure grew brighter and brighter until it shone like a second sun on Shar'gel.""
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Nine
When the Burning Legion beset the draenei on Shar'gel, Askara finally understood the strange vision of the future she had seen so long ago. One day, her people would locate a new home, but she was not fated to join them. She would die on Shar'gel to give them a chance to find that sanctuary.
Askara and seventy other draenei volunteered to distract the Legion. With their blood, they would buy the rest of the renegades the time to escape Shar'gel. The battle between the demons and these brave defenders would go down as one of the greatest instances of self-sacrifice in draenei history.
Hundreds of demons smashed into the seventy-one like a battering ram of fel-forged steel, but the defenders gave no ground. Not a single inch. Every time a draenei teetered on the brink of death, Askara was there. She charged through the battle lines and mended the wounded with T'uure's holy Light.
Because of Askara, the seventy-one fought with the courage and strength of a thousand. Because of her, the draenei race escaped annihilation.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Ten
After the Battle of Shar'gel, T'uure fell into the Burning Legion's hands. The demons had witnessed Askara's heroic last stand, and they attributed her immense power to the strange artifact. Legion forces squabbled over control of the relic before Kil'jaeden the Deceiver finally decided whom it would go to.
He entrusted the artifact to an eredar priestess named Lady Calindris. She was one of the few demons who understood the draenei's holy magics. What was more, Calindris had an intimate knowledge of T'uure itself. Long ago on Argus, the priestess had acted as a caretaker of the eredar's holy relics.
It took years before Calindris finally bent T'uure to her will. After a series of grim rituals, she transformed the artifact into a dark reflection of itself. Where once T'uure inspired hope, now it would spread fear. Where once the relic healed, now it would cause wounds to fester.
T'uure, Beacon of the Naaru, Part Eleven
Lady Calindris relished bending T'uure to her will and using its corrupted power against her foes. She loathed the draenei, and the thought of befouling their cherished artifact delighted her to no end.
Calindris grew so talented at wielding T'uure that the demon lord Kil'jaeden gave her a special task. She would serve as a torturer on the Legion's prison worlds. Calindris was well suited for this role. She made an art out of inflicting suffering on her captives, and images of T'uure filled their nightmares.
Much like Askara, Calindris eventually received a vision of the future. She foresaw the Legion invading the world of Azeroth and bathing it in fel fire. Strangely, Calindris herself was not there.
But T'uure was. A stranger wielded the artifact in its glorious true form, and its Light blinded the Legion's forces, shining over the land like a second sun.
